3 season room - Like a three-season sunroom, an all-season sunroom is a room that consists of many windows. However, these are usually double or triple pane windows. Also, windows in an all-season sunroom are typically coated with Low-E coating, or are sometimes tinted.They may also be gas filled, which provides extra insulation.. …

A 3-season room costs $8,000 to $50,000 on average, depending on the size, finishing options, and foundation. Building a three-season room addition costs $80 to $230 per square foot. Three-season sunrooms typically lack insulation, heating, cooling, and electricity. Also known as "sun porches" in Northern Virginia, three season rooms with glass window panels allow you to see the beautiful views while keeping the elements, ... Ceramic Tile. Ceramic tile will be another excellent flooring option for your unheated sunroom. It is more expensive than the laminate surface. But the sweet spot of ceramic tile is- easy to install, and you can put them directly on the concrete slab. Another plus of this flooring type is you can sweep or mop with ease. The cost of a 3 season room can range anywhere from $10,000 to $70,000. The range in cost is so large because of a variety of factors. Materials, labor, the market. Let’s break …The issue is some three-season rooms are not built like your home. The exterior walls of your three-season room may rest on top of the finished flooring and pass under the wall to the outside. Your three-season room may be on a slab and the slab is wider/longer than the exterior walls. Make sure to have systems in place to circulate fresh air.Sep 6, 2021 · An average size sunroom costs $100 to $350 per square foot. A 3 season room costs about $8,000 to $50,000 to build while a 4 season room costs $20,000 to $80,000 due to the higher quality construction materials used, including dual-pane glass, insulation, and structural engineering.
